Arsenal make £50m bid for Noni Madueke

Arsenal have submitted an official bid for Chelsea winger Noni Madueke, offering a package worth around £50 million, including add-ons, as Mikel Arteta pushes ahead with a summer reshaping of his attacking options.

The bid was first reported by Fabrizio Romano, who stated that while Chelsea are holding out for more than £50m guaranteed, negotiations between the two clubs are ongoing and described the relationship between the sides as positive.

He added that Madueke has already agreed personal terms with Arsenal.

Arsenal’s move comes after a week of escalating developments. David Ornstein also reported for The Athletic that Madueke had agreed terms with Arsenal, although, at that point, there had been no formal contact between the clubs.

Sami Mokbel, writing for the BBC, later confirmed that while personal terms had been agreed, there was still no agreement over the fee.

Ed Aarons, writing for The Guardian, reported that Chelsea are seeking a minimum of £50m for Madueke but are open to negotiations. That valuation was echoed by Sam Dean, Sam Wallace, and Mike McGrath in The Telegraph, who suggest the west London club are expecting offers above that threshold.

Madueke joined Chelsea from PSV Eindhoven in January 2023 for a reported £29m and has made 92 appearances for the club, scoring 20 goals, with nine assists.

Though talented, his career punctuated by numerous injuries, and with Chelsea under pressure to balance their books, the 23-year-old has emerged as a viable option.
